Abstract

The utility model relates to intrusion preventing alarm systems, including at least one optical-fiber intelligent processing equipment, at least one patrol sentry post station alert process unit and induction optical cable unit, each patrol sentry post station alert process unit is made of optical-fiber intelligent alarm host machine and data processing host, optical-fiber intelligent processing equipment includes intelligent optical front-end processor and intelligent optical terminal handler, optical-fiber intelligent alarm host machine is connect by transmission cable with intelligent optical front-end processor, optical-fiber intelligent alarm host machine includes light source mechanism, photoelectric information processing mechanism and linkage output mechanism, data processing host includes data gather computer structure and alarm mechanism.Therefore, the utility model high sensitivity, optical-fiber intelligent alarm host machine and data processing host match setting, various intrusion behaviors can be found in time, and pattern match is carried out to intrusion behavior, have the advantages that high reliablity, positioning accuracy are high, it can effectively reduce person works' intensity, improve working efficiency.

Background technique
Border or border area refer to the regional scope on neighbouring boundary, national boundaries in political science and geography, in general have Special importance be all the important set of national security all the time to the circumference security alarm of boundary line and monitoring management At part and important leverage.Illegal border crossing behavior usually constitutes serious threat to nation's security, and cause military, politics and The ill effect of diplomatic aspect.How personnel illegal border crossing as various countries in frontier defense field in the urgent need to address problem is taken precautions against.
Currently, countries in the world put into a large amount of human and material resources and financial resources carry out border security alarm monitoring the relevant technologies Research.It is existing that the behavior for entering boundary line circumference is identified using sensor, signal processor and processing software etc., judge It whether is the system that warning message is generated to illegal invasion after illegal invasion.Also have anti-using ecthoaeum protective net progress physical isolation Shield carries out search maintenance by frontier officer's patrol in critical junction region installation electric video monitoring.
Traditional border means of defence carries out physical isolation protection using ecthoaeum protective net, installs electronics in critical junction region Video monitoring carries out search maintenance by patrol personnel patrol.However the perimeter distance of boundary line is longer, boundary line circumference is polycyclic greatly Border is extremely complex, mostly desert, mountain area etc., and the animal species to haunt are various.Frontier officer can not keep whole section of route completely There is the problems such as frontier officer goes on patrol great work intensity, working efficiency is low in search simultaneously.The prior art also utilizes sensing The alarm system of device, signal processor and processing software, although can usually find intrusion behavior in time, to intrusion behavior mould It is to be improved that formula matches positioning accuracy, that is, it is to be improved to invade definitely rate.

Specific embodiment
With reference to the accompanying drawings and examples, specific embodiment of the present utility model is described in further detail.Below Embodiment is not intended to limit the scope of the present invention for illustrating the utility model.
Referring to Fig. 1 and Fig. 2, boundary line periphery intrusion preventing alarm system of the utility model based on Fibre Optical Sensor, including extremely A few optical-fiber intelligent processing equipment 1, at least one patrol sentry post station alert process unit 2 and induction optical cable unit 3.Fig. 1 is aobvious Each patrol sentry post station alert process unit 2 is shown as by optical-fiber intelligent alarm host machine 20 interconnected and data processing master Machine 21 is constituted, wherein the optical-fiber intelligent processing equipment 1 includes by the intelligent optical front-end processing interconnected of induction optical fiber 13 Device 11 and intelligent optical terminal handler 12, the optical-fiber intelligent alarm host machine 20 is by transmission cable and intelligent optical front-end processor 11 connections, the optical-fiber intelligent alarm host machine 20 include light source mechanism 201, photoelectric information processing mechanism 202 and linkage output machine Structure 203, the data processing host 21 include data gather computer structure 211 and alarm mechanism 212, optical-fiber intelligent alarm host machine 20 with Data processing host 21 connects.
Optical-fiber intelligent processing equipment 1 is mounted on boundary line circumference scene, and optical-fiber intelligent alarm host machine 20 is mounted on boundary line Sentry post computer room is gone on patrol, data processing host 21 is mounted on boundary line sentry post computer room.A set of optical-fiber intelligent processing equipment 1 passes through transmission Optical cable is connect with optical-fiber intelligent alarm host machine 20.The induction optical cable of the induction optical cable unit 3 is two core optical cables, journey Z-shaped paving If incuding optical cable unit 3 includes transmission cable or induction optical fiber 13.It can be one by above-mentioned a set of optical-fiber intelligent processing equipment 1 The defence area positioned over long distances is responsible at defence area, a sentry post, and maximum distance may be implemented in a set of optical-fiber intelligent processing equipment 1 The deployment of 50km, the utility model may include the most 64 optical-fiber intelligent processing equipments 1.
In order to further optimize the utility model effect, in a kind of embodiment of utility model, in foregoing teachings On the basis of, the optical-fiber intelligent processing equipment 1 further includes audio monitoring module 14.Audio monitoring module 14 be mounted on need into The important place of row audio monitoring.The light source mechanism 201 includes light branching unit module 204, and light branching unit module 204 is according to existing The quantity of field actual fiber Intelligent treatment equipment 1 carries out light splitting configuration, and light source mechanism 201 can adjust light power size through backstage To be applicable in Different field situation.Photoelectric information processing mechanism 202 can carry out gain adjustment according to each defence area actual conditions.It is described Dynamic output mechanism 203 links with alarm ancillary equipment 205, the alarm ancillary equipment 205 including combined aural and visual alarm or and video Equipment, and the utility model can put video equipment in certain critical positions.Preferably, the alarm mechanism 212 includes mode Identification module, break alarm module, defence area setup module, alarm over long distances locating module, alarm output module or data exchange One of module or multiple combinations can such as carry out short message transmission, mail is sent, carries out data friendship with freeway management platform Mutually etc..

Optical-fiber intelligent processing equipment 1 is mounted in maintenance well, and maintenance well size is 0.8x0.8x0.8, and transmission cable journey Z-shaped is fixed on On the protective net of boundary line.The installation of Tthe utility model system is mainly through following step:
The length in single defence area, i.e., a set of optical-fiber intelligent processing equipment 1 is determined according to boundary line actual environment, in a public affairs In differ to 10 kilometers, each defence area is not interfere with each other independently of each other;
The installation induction optical cable on the boom net of boundary line, using straight line Z-shaped laying method, by each region of boom net Covering, each peak width is the same, and induction optical cable is enabled to effectively to sense the vibration that boom net any position generates, and protects Protect entire boom net;
Maintenance well is built in the initial position in each defence area, optical-fiber intelligent processing equipment 1 is placed in maintenance well, convenient for entire The maintenance work of system;
Transmission cable is connected to from each intelligent optical front-end processor 11 from computer room pull-out, by signal from intelligent optical Computer room is passed back at front-end processor 11, which goes on patrol 2 position of sentry post station alert process unit, is located in sentry post 4;
As shown in figure 3, boundary line periphery intrusion preventing alarm method of the utility model based on Fibre Optical Sensor, including following steps Suddenly,
S1, optical-fiber intelligent alarm host machine 20 issue light signal to intelligent optical front-end processor 11;
S2, intelligent optical front-end processor 11 receive optical signal and handle, and the vibration of the sensed optical cable of optical signal generates light Signal intensity;
S3, intelligent optical terminal handler 12 receive the optical signal after variation and processing, will treated optical signal through feeling Optical fiber 13 is answered to be transferred to intelligent optical front-end processor 11, the vibration of the sensed optical cable of optical signal generates change in optical signal, intelligence Optical front-end processor 11 receives the optical signal after the variation, through being transferred to optical-fiber intelligent alarm host machine by transmission cable after processing 20;
S4, it is electric signal that optical-fiber intelligent alarm host machine 20, which receives optical signal and carries out photoelectric conversion,;
S5, data processing host 21 receive electric signal and carry out data analysis and pattern-recognition, and by treated, data are returned Optical-fiber intelligent alarm host machine 20.
Pattern-recognition described in step S5, acquisition environmental signal and simulation alarm signal generate original sample letter in advance first Number, the signal acquired when by operation is matched with original sampled signal, calculates the alarm probabilities value of signal to complete mould Formula identification.The original sample further includes the steps that wrong report and the signal correction failed to report and regenerates original sample information. It is specific as follows:
System building finishes whether test signal normal, debugging signal makes it normally start to acquire data;
Round-the-clock environmental data is acquired, data are saved, completes the acquisition of environmental data;
This kind of signal is acquired by artificially simulating a series of intrusion behavior and saves data, completes artificial invasion data Acquisition;
The environmental data saved and artificial invasion data are subjected to pattern drill and identification.
The training and identification of mode: by raw data base environmental data and artificial invasion data carry out pattern drill with Identification is used to distinguish the data processing of interference signal and alarm signal based on the automatic learning art of big data machine, system according to On-site actual situations acquire environmental signal and simulation alarm signal in advance, generate original sample by pattern drill;System operation When the signal for reaching acquisition condition is acquired, and carry out matching primitives with original sample and go out the alarm probabilities value of signal.Mould Formula identification function is to carry out artificial violate-action to system during system trial run, to the signal system for occurring reporting by mistake and failing to report The automatic wrong report of increase again of system fails to report signal and carries out pattern drill, generates new sample data.
The working principle of the utility model is as follows: light source mechanism 201 issues optical signal, warp in optical-fiber intelligent alarm host machine 20 It crosses transmission cable and reaches Intelligent optical fiber front end sensors, optical signal reaches intelligence by induction optical cable by optical fiber front end sensors again Optical front-end processor 11, optical signals intelligent optical terminal handler 12 again pass by induction optical cable and reach intelligent optical front end Processor 11, optical signal are connected to the photoelectric information processing mechanism 202 of optical-fiber intelligent alarm host machine 20 finally by transmission cable;Through The optical signal for crossing photoelectric information processing mechanism 202 is converted into can be used for the electric signal of signal processing, by data processing host 21 Data acquisition, the setting of pattern-recognition and alarm software to signal determines warning message, reaches generating for alert if Warning message, and make warning output and carry out data interaction with freeway management platform.
